PURPOSE:

The Senior Product Manager - Consumer is essential for driving the business's success and growth by overseeing a portfolio of products that address customer needs and add value to the Performance Brands business. This role involves defining and communicating the vision and strategy for Royal Purple and Bel-Ray products and portfolios, while managing the entire product life cycle from concept to various stages of maturity. The Senior Product Manager - Consumer will evaluate the broader industry and market, identifying changes and trends that present significant business challenges or opportunities to foster product development activities(launch, enhance, sunset). Additionally, the role requires building strong, collaborative relationships with business partners across the organization to identify efficienciesand enhance execution.

OBJECTIVESAND RESPONSIBILITIES:


  • Develop and communicate a 5-year product line strategy, ensuring alignment with marketing and customer strategies.
  • Understand future automotive and powersports markettrends and communicate key insights to internal stakeholders.
  • Know Performance Brands' key consumer customers and understand the competitive landscape.
  • Develop and communicate the product line value proposition to key internal stakeholders.
  • Coordinate business case development with marketing and sales (size of prize, chance of success, investmentrequired).
  • Manage the product portfolio throughout the product lifecycle.
  • Define pricing for new product introductions and track success metrics.
  • Keep up to date on market pricing and provide insights to thepricing coordinator/sales.
  • Develop product line architecture and ensure product claims/approvals are up to date with R&D.
  • Lead, coach, develop, and manage consumer product management and R&D team
  • Work closely with R&D to ensure timely newproduct introductions.
  • Continuous process improvement including businesscase management, product development and commercialization.
  • Engage with procurement and operations for new product planning, forecasting, and alternate raw materials.
  • Engage and support third-party relationships, including key additive and base oils suppliers.
  • Use 80/20 principles to manage product complexity and identify more cost-effective formulations.
  • Help advocate market position and work with Marketing to promote the product line.
  • Other duties as assigned.
